方法一: isdigit是計算機C(C++)語言中的一個函數,主要用於檢查其參數是否為十進制數字字符。 isalpha是一種函數:判斷字符ch是否為英文字母,若為英文字母,返回非0(小寫字母為2,大寫字母為1)。若不是字母,返回0。在標准c中相當於使用“ isupper( ch ...
s為字符串 s.isalnum() 所有字符都是數字或者字母,為真返回 Ture,否則返回 False。(重點,這是字母數字一起判斷的!!) s.isalpha() 所有字符都是字母,為真返回 Ture,否則返回 False。(只判斷字母) s.isdigit() 所有字符都是數字,為真返回 ...
輸入一行字符,判斷不同字符的數量, 分別用for循環和while循環完成 for循環 運用了字符串方法, isupper()判斷是否為大寫字母 islower()判斷是否為小寫字母 isdigit()判斷是否為數字 while循環 判斷部分用的字符串切片 ...
利用字符串的decode方法,如果不是對應字符編碼,報異常,然后返回False 是否為ascii字符: 是否為ascii字符中字母數字: ...
對於python輸入數據類型判斷正確與否的函數大致有三類: (1)type(),它的作用直接可以判斷出數據的類型 (2)isinstance(),它可以判斷任何一個數據與相應的數據類型是否一致,比較常用。 (3)對於任何一個程序,需要輸入特定的數據類型,這個時候就需要在程序 ...
在寫物理實驗圖像處理的腳本時,遇到了一個判斷輸入的字符串是否為數字的方法 最開始我的思路是這個 用的是系統自帶的String.isdigit()的方法,該方法用於判定輸入的字符串是否為純數。如果是純數,則返回True,否則返回False。 但是這樣有一個問題,浮點數中有dot這個符號 ...